The larger predeclared evaluations follow that runtime gate. The Hub's approximately `3B` badge counts packed quantized storage tensors. It does not mean this is a newly trained 3B model; the logical source architecture is Bonsai 27B. This repository preserves the first bounded oQe 2-bit output that loaded and generated normally on a 32 GB Apple Silicon host. Its purpose is reproducible pipeline evidence and storage, not a recommended deployment target. ## What this proves - An oQe-enhanced 2-bit MLX artifact could be produced from the public BF16 conversion baseline and loaded by the local oMLX runtime. - The 32-sample calibration completed with 496 imatrix entries. - On fixed 10-question smoke screens it scored HellaSwag 7/10 and ARC-Challenge 6/10. - Single-request oMLX generation measured 15.71 tok/s at a 1,024-token prompt and 15.44 tok/s at 4,096 tokens, with cache disabled. ## What this does not prove The sensitivity stage was intentionally minimal: 2 samples of 64 tokens. The artifact has not passed the predeclared 100-question evaluations or a quality-sized sensitivity pass. It must not be compared with a validated Q4, Q8, oQ4, or oQ8 checkpoint as though it were a quality result. ## Reproduction Parameters | Setting | Value | | --- | ---: | | oQ level | 2 | | imatrix samples | 32 | | imatrix sequence length | 512 | | sensitivity samples | 2 | | sensitivity sequence length | 64 | | calibration dataset | `oqe_code_multilingual` | | imatrix entries | 496 | `oq_imatrix_report.json`, `PROVENANCE.json`, and the included `IMATRIX_CACHE_SHA256.npz` record the exact emitted artifact and calibration evidence.
